The Same Roots

Portuguese and Spanish have the same language roots. They are both Ibero-Romance languages that stem from Vulgar Latin, as with many Romance languages like French and Catalan. In fact, Spanish and Portuguese have 89% lexical similarities, which means that many of the vocabulary words and phrases are the same across the board. This definitely makes it easier when learning the language. At the same time, be mindful of the cognates because many words look similar but do not mean the same thing in both languages. For example, salads in Spanish means too much salt, but in Portuguese, it means salad.

Written and Spoken Forms

Another great thing about both of these languages is that they have the same written form subject+verb+object. Therefore, Spanish speakers can easily understand the written form of Portuguese. However, when It comes to speaking the language, this is where things get a little bit messy. If you have dabbled in Portuguese even a little bit, you know how hard the accent is to master. Portuguese isn't as much of a phonetic language (what you see is what you get) like Spanish is. Also, there are no "v" or z" sounds in Spanish, which is prevalent in Portuguese. In addition to that Portuguese, has extra nasally consonant sounds that Spanish lacks. This is why Spanish speakers can't understand Portuguese speakers as well as the other way around.

How long does it take to learn Portuguese if you know Spanish?

Learning Portuguese on a fluent level takes approximately the same amount of time as Spanish, with around 600 hours of study during six months.

Should I learn Portuguese after Spanish?

Since Portuguese and Spanish are both major Romance languages, learning Portuguese is a logical next step after Spanish. They share many similarities, such as vocabulary, pronunciation, some grammar rules etc.
